JOB SUMMARY:
This role will be responsible for collaborating with other surveyors, engineers or designers on projects for state, regional, local, and private clients performing a variety of tasks in the preparation of plans and/or tasks on multiple projects, as well as leading/overseeing and checking the survey work of others. The position will function as a work group leader in the development of engineering plans related to all facets of the surveying. It is expected the position may plan, organize, lead, and implement various work in support of other project managers in the organization.
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S:
Operational/Technical
• Act as Work Group Leader on various size projects.
• Supervise and guide the organization on projects related to surveying functions performed within the organization.
• Review preliminary and final design drawings, review or check surveying computations, specifications, and report writing, etc.
• Promote excellent internal and external client service throughout the organization.
• Perform checking of survey related drawings.
• Prepare contract documents, plans, and sketches utilizing client approved design software.
• Perform/check horizontal and vertical geometry calculations as needed.
• Perform and check quantity calculations.
• Assist in supervising the efforts within the organization, including developing the technical skills and project knowledge of co-workers.
• Assist in monitoring the performance of projects, including quality, schedule, and budget.
• Participate in project site and project status meetings.
• Develop project survey related workplans.
• Assist in development of scope of work, budget/man-hours, and schedule recovery plans.
• Keep up to date with new technology, survey equipment and advancements.
• Provide support to other offices as needed.

EDUCATION, EXPERIENCE AND SKILLS REQUIRED:
· Associates or Bachelor’s degree in surveying or related field required.
· Minimum five (5) years of relevant related experience.
· Pennsylvania Professional Land Surveyor License in good standing required.
· Ability to communicate effectively with ownership, management, co-workers, customers, vendors, contractors, partners, and other stakeholders.
· Applied knowledge of applicable local, state, and federal statutes and guidelines with respect
· to field.
· Knowledge of CDR-M Design and Office Procedures.
· Knowledge of clients' design manuals, procedures, specifications, standards, computer programs, applicable design codes, engineering software, and plan presentation format.
· Knowledge of written communications including technical reports, letters, meeting minutes, etc.
· Knowledge of highway, right-of-way, property, ALTA/NSPS Land Title, and subdivision development and deliverables.
· Skilled in the use of relevant computer software as needed, including but not limited to, Bentley MicroStation CADD, Autodesk AutoCAD, Civil 3D, and Bluebeam as well as other online resources.
· Ability to effectively check and/or review design drawings.
